![]() | Mother Fern Asplenium viviparum Polypodiaceae Leaves dissected and appear like the foliage of a carrot; small aerial plantlets form on the midribs of the mother plant's foliage. Plant Form or Habit: curved Plant Use: pot plant Exposure: medium Flower Color: n/a Blooming Period: Height: 11/2 feet Width: 1 1/2 feet Foliage Texture: medium Heat Tolerance: medium Water Requirements: medium Additional Comments: Keep soil slightly damp, watch for insect damage or root rot. High humidity is desirable.
